What is SEO?
Imagine you’re looking for a new patio set. You probably pull out your phone and type “patio furniture Sarasota” into Google. The list of results that appear? That’s where SEO comes in.
SEO is the process of enhancing your online presence so that when customers search for services like yours, your website shows up higher in the search results. This increased visibility leads to more clicks on your site, more inquiries, and ideally, more customers.
Why is SEO Essential for Small Businesses?
-
Visibility: Most people don’t scroll past the first page of Google results. If your business isn’t on that page, chances are no one will find you.
-
Credibility: Companies that appear near the top of the search results are often perceived as more trustworthy. Customers tend to choose businesses they see first.
-
Cost-Effective Marketing: Compared to traditional advertising methods, SEO is more affordable in the long run. Once your site is optimized, it can attract customers without ongoing pay-per-click fees.

Practical SEO tips for Your Patio Business
-
keyword research: Identify the words and phrases that local customers use when searching for services you offer. Use tools like Google Keyword Planner or even simple Google searches to see what’s popular.
-
Optimize Your Website: Include these keywords in strategic places on your website, like titles, headings, and page descriptions. Just remember, it should read naturally—don’t stuff keywords.
-
Claim Your Google My Business Listing: This is crucial for local SEO. Fill in all the information—business hours, services, and contact details. Encourage happy customers to leave positive reviews.
-
Create Local Content: Write blog posts or articles about special patio design tips specific to Sarasota’s climate or trends. This not only provides value but also helps your site rank higher.
-
Mobile-Friendly Site: Ensure your website is easy to navigate on a mobile device. Many customers will search for services on their phones, especially when they’re out and about.
FAQs about SEO for Small Businesses
1. What’s the first step I should take for SEO?
Start with keyword research. Find out what your potential customers are searching for and use those words on your website.
2. How long will it take to see results from SEO?
SEO is not an overnight fix. It may take a few months to see significant changes, but be patient—good things come to those who wait!
3. Do I need to hire an expert for SEO?
While you can start on your own, hiring an SEO professional can help save you time and ensure a more comprehensive strategy.
4. What is local SEO, and why is it important?
Local SEO focuses on optimizing your online presence for local search queries. This is even more crucial for businesses like yours that serve specific geographic areas.
5. Can I do SEO myself?
Absolutely! With basic knowledge and a bit of time, many small business owners have successfully implemented their own SEO strategies.
